Antique Chestnut Warmer, English, Brass, Hanging Roaster, Georgian, Circa 1800

About the Item

This is an antique chestnut warmer. An English, brass hanging roaster, dating to the Georgian period, circa 1800. Fascinating Georgian warmer with an appealing decorative motif Displays a desirable aged patina and in good original order Brass presents warm golden hues with minimal tarnishing Lid adorned with a relief mount of heralding angels Octagonal form to the warmer, with pierced cooling holes Pierced fretwork to the handle, with hanging loop inset to handle This is a charming antique chestnut warmer, with a wonderful golden appearance and appealing aged patina. Delivered ready to display. Dimensions: Max Width: 16cm (6.25'') Max Depth: 7cm (2.75'') Max Height: 54.5cm (21.5'')
